RJ45 with integrated magnetics saves space and eliminates manufacturing failures
25 April 2001
Interconnection
By integrating magnetic components inside a shielded jack connector housing, FCI says its Netjack RJ45 connector saves PCB space, simplifies components placement and helps products comply with EMC requirements.
With an industry standard RJ45 footprint, the modular Netjack connector offers a choice of magnetic assemblies to meet with 10/100Base-T, ATM and Token Ring specifications. By moving custom common mode choke and transformer configurations inside the connector, equipment designers can reduce PCB size or accommodate additional circuitry instead.
Manufactured to be compatible with all regular wave solder, IR and vapour phase manufacturing processes, product failures resulting from differences in thermal expansion rates of the PCB and discrete magnetic component packages are avoided. In addition, with integrated magnetics, the number of component placement operations are reduced.
Netjack RJ45 connectors are currently offered in single row format, in 1, 2, 4, 6 and 8 port sizes and are available as surface mount or through-hole types. The connectors' one-piece enhanced shield design and choice of grounding options simplifies compliance with the requirements of electromagnetic compatibility standards.
